Mineral Resource Classification

Mineral resource classification is a way to categorize how much mineral material is present and how confidently we know it exists. It generally includes categories like "Measured," "Indicated," and "Inferred." "Measured" means we have detailed, reliable data confirming the quantity and quality of the resource. "Indicated" means the data is good but less precise, allowing estimation but with more uncertainty. "Inferred" is based on limited data, suggesting the presence of minerals but with less certainty. These classifications help investors and developers assess the potential value and feasibility of mining a deposit.
